Lloyd’s of London says ex-boss’s ‘close relationship’ breached compliance rules

Lloyd’s of London says ex-boss’s ‘close relationship’ breached compliance rules

Lloyd’s of London has ruled that its former boss John Neal breached compliance rules by failing to disclose a “close relationship” with a female colleague that risked triggering conflict of interest concerns at the insurance market.

An investigation by the Council of Lloyd’s, which is responsible for the market’s management and supervision, said it could not find any “conclusive evidence” Neal was romantically involved with the company’s then corporate affairs director, nor that there were any process failures relating to her promotion during Neal’s tenure.
